A classic novella by Ernest Hemingway, first published in 1952. It is one of Hemingway's most celebrated works and played a major role in his receiving the Nobel Prize in Literature.

The story follows Santiago, an aging Cuban fisherman who has gone eighty-four days without catching a fish. Determined to prove his skill and dignity, he ventures far into the Gulf Stream and hooks an enormous marlin. What follows is an epic struggle between man and nature, testing Santiago's endurance, courage, and spirit.

Though simple in plot, the novella explores profound themes of perseverance, pride, loneliness, determination, and the human struggle against overwhelming odds.

Hemingway's clear and powerful writing style makes the story accessible while giving it great emotional and symbolic depth.
